William A. Beersactive 1850 - 1889

William A. Beers was a photographer in New Haven from about 1850 to 1889. In the course of his career, he produced daguerreotypes, ambrotypes, and crayon miniatures as well as well as albumen prints. Although he apparently first appears in the New Haven city directory in 1854, the imprint on the back of one of his portrait photographs states that the firm was "Established 1850."
